Algeria – workers of the Sidi Bellabas plantaion went on a strike to protest the delay of their wages for four months, as well as the lack of support and projects, stressing that the administration promised to pay wages however their promises have not been met. The protesters called for dialogue to reach a solution pointing that there are several plantation in the country that do not suffer bad conditions, workers called on the first judge in the country to intervene as they suffer from the nonpayment of salaries. The plantation currently employ 72 workers, and it used to employ about 120 workers in 19 hectares, as it plants roses, forest trees and others.
